Please tell me how to enable Wildcard DNS on my server for only one domain?!


This is the requirements from here:

To install and run BlogHoster, you will need:

1. PHP 4.2.0 or newer installed
2. An available MySQL database
3. FTP access to your server

For the randomly-generated image verification feature to work (optional feature), you will need:

1. GD Libraries 2.0 or newer installed, and accessible with PHP

For the subdirectory-style weblog URLs feature to work (optional feature), you will need:

1. The ability to use .htaccess files (usually requires that your server is running Apache)
2. mod_rewrite enabled (default for most Apache servers)

For the subdomain-style weblog URLs feature to work (optional feature), you will also need:

1. Wildcard DNS setup on your server.
